Northumbrian Water is seeking a Risk Analyst to join the Asset Programme Management Office. You will play a key role in ensuring compliance with risk management best practices and support the capital project community in improving risk maturity through effective analysis and communication.
The role requires excellent communication skills and proficiency in current risk analysis techniques. A hybrid working model is offered, with office presence required in Durham.
